Though wife Mariah Carey was nowhere to be seen, the mom-to-be is opening up about longstanding rumours she is bisexual.
The Oh Santa songstress has long faced allegations she is secretly gay, despite being married twice.
Now, the 40-year-old superstar has addressed the unfounded gossip in a new interview for gay magazine The Advocate.
She says, “If it makes somebody happy to say that, then whatever, but that’s not the reality. I don’t have a discriminatory policy of who I’m friends with, so yes, I’m friends with women who are gay – gay, straight, it doesn’t matter to me. So I don’t get upset when I hear that, because it is what it is. I guess I could lie about it to seem more exciting.”
For her part, Mimi insists she is fully supportive of gay rights and backs the U.S. campaign for same-sex marriage to be made legal.
She adds, “If two people want to get married, it’s their prerogative – we hope. Everybody should be able to do what they want to do and be in the pursuit of happiness. Ever since I was a little girl, my mother was very open-minded and had many different types of friends, so being gay never seemed wrong or strange to me.”
